There’s No Yeezy Release This Month, And That’s A Good Thing

You can sum up how 2016 is going in sneakers with one word: Yeezy.

We’re two months and change into the year, and from the first of January to the middle of March, all anyone has wanted to talk about is Yeezys. Hypebeasts thirst over them. High schoolers wonder why they can’t get them, and scour the internet for believable fake pairs. Haters scoff and turn their noses up at them (they’re probably just salty they can’t get a pair). The hype train has been incredibly real, and doesn’t show any signs of slowing down any time soon.

However, Adidas dropped a bombshell recently: there will be no Yeezy release in March.

Although many may be bemoaning this news, it’s actually a good thing. As much as we love Yeezys, we’ve got to admit that the sneaker game in 2016 has become somewhat one-dimensional. The thirst for Kanye’s product has overshadowed a lot of great releases from other brands, and the hype has become borderline unbearable.

There’s a lot of dope stuff out in the world of sneakers, and when you hone in on one thing, a lot of it might go over your head. It’s important to keep your options open, and explore what kind of kicks are out there. We can’t blame you for getting caught up in the Yeezy hype. We’ve gladly gotten caught up ourselves. It happens. The shoes are fire, and the marketing is great. No shame in that.

A month off from Yeezys might just be what everyone really needs. Sneakerheads have an opportunity to look at some different stuff (dope releases like the Flyknit Air Forces have flown somewhat under the weather), and gather their thoughts before the next round of madness begins (we’re assuming some time in April). 2016 might be the year of Yeezy, but a month off is certainly not a bad thing.
